What are the responsibilities and job description for the Library Page position at Kearney, City of (NE)?
JOB
Under close supervision, shelve and retrieve materials; assist with routine circulation procedures. Work varies somewhat with minimal leeway for discretion and independent judgment.
EXAMPLE OF DUTIES
Shelve materials in the correct order according to type, read shelves to ensure ease of finding materials, aid with minor projects and programs.SUPERVISION - RESPONSIBILITY FOR WORK OF OTHERS: NoneES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S: Apply knowledge of alphabetization. (Daily)Regular timely/punctual attendance. (Daily)Apply knowledge of numeration up to four digits past the decimal point. (Daily)Establish and maintain effective working relationships with fellow employees, officials and the public. (Daily)Effectively communicate orally and in writing. (Daily)Assigned projects are performed properly and efficiently. (Daily)Speak clearly and concisely. (Daily)Apply basic knowledge of library operations. (Daily)PHYSICAL DEMANDS OF 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S: Work Type: Medium, exerting up to 50 pounds of force occasionally, and/or up to 20 pounds of force frequently, and /or up to 10 pounds of force constantly to move objectsClimbing/Balancing: Moderate, ability to climb ladder and step stoolWalking: Frequent amount requiredStooping/Bending: FrequentlyStand/Sit: Stand about 95% of the timeReaching: Frequent, overhead as well as horizontalVision: Adequate to perform essential job functionsColor Vision: Adequate to perform essential job functionsHearing: None RequiredSpeech: None RequiredEye/Hand/Foot Coordination: Minimal equipment operationManual Dexterity: Minimal abilityENVIRONMENTAL DEMANDS OF 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S: Inside/Outside: InsideCold/Heat: ControlledWet/Dry: ControlledNoise/Vibrations: Office equipmentHazards: NoneFumes/Dust/Odors: NoneInfectious Diseases: Low exposureMENTAL REQUIREMENTS OF 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S: Ability to speak clearly and concisely.Ability to understand and follow written and oral instructions.Ability to listen to and apply information and instructions.Ability to understand mathematical concepts to include basic arithmetic.
SUPPLEMENTAL INFORMATION
MACHINES, TOOLS, EQUIPMENT AND WORK AIDS USED: Book Cart, Stapler, Photocopier, Paper Cutter.REMARKS: The above position description is intended to describe the duties of an employee in general terms and does not necessarily describe all of his/her duties.
